IMPORTANT: This ride has a small hole in the bell that was drilled there to eliminate a small imperfection that resulted in a micro crack. It also has a small foundry “scab” in the underside around the middle of the bow (as exemplified in the pictures). These blemishes have a minuscule to no chance whatsoever of transforming into problems or cracks in the future. The bell suffer very little elastic deformation during play in comparison to other parts of the body, hence no chance of spreading any crack, specially as the crack was all eliminated. The scab, even though it looks scary in the picture taken with a macro lens, in reality it is only 0.3mm in its deepest area, whilst the cymbal’s thickness rounds between 1.5 to 2.0mm. Meaning, the depth of the blemish is lesser than the thickness difference between the upper bow and the edge (thanks to tapering). It is an insignificant difference that should result in no problems in the future.

O.a.k (One-of-a-kind):

This line of instruments acts as my space for study and unbounded creativity. It is the continuation of my original non-serialized work, meaning, a cymbal line where anything goes. 


It will most likely also act as the breeding grounds for any forthcoming new lines and designs as time moves forward, so keep your eyes open, one of these could one day become a regular act.
